Understanding the Treatment Options for Large Pores
There are several methods for treating large pores, each with varying costs and benefits. The most popular treatments range from professional in-office procedures to at-home skincare routines. While professional treatments often deliver quicker, more noticeable results, they typically come at a higher price point. On the other hand, at-home options tend to be more budget-friendly but may require longer periods to achieve desired outcomes.

Professional Treatments for Large Pores
Professional treatments are ideal for individuals seeking more immediate results or dealing with more severe cases of large pores. These treatments often require a skilled practitioner and may involve advanced technology. Common professional options include chemical peels, microneedling, laser treatments, and laser toning. While these methods can be highly effective, they often come with a higher price tag due to the expertise and equipment involved.
However, the price can vary significantly depending on factors such as treatment type, the area being treated, and the frequency of sessions. More invasive treatments like laser resurfacing or microneedling may require multiple sessions for optimal results, which can increase the overall cost. Additionally, advanced lasers or deep chemical peels tend to cost more due to their ability to target deeper layers of the skin for enhanced results.
At-Home Treatments for Large Pores
For those seeking a more affordable option, at-home treatments can be an effective way to manage large pores. Over-the-counter products such as pore-minimizing cleansers, exfoliants, and topical retinoids are widely available and tend to be more budget-friendly. These treatments often focus on exfoliating the skin, removing dead skin cells, and unclogging pores, which can help minimize their appearance over time.
At-home treatments may not offer the immediate results of professional treatments, but they can be an excellent choice for individuals looking for a consistent, long-term skincare solution. The cost of at-home treatments is typically much lower than in-office procedures, but it’s essential to understand that achieving visible results may take time and consistent use.
Factors Affecting the Cost of Pore Treatments
Several factors influence the financial considerations for treating large pores. Understanding these variables can help you make a more informed decision about which treatment to pursue.
Treatment Frequency
Some treatments, such as chemical peels or microneedling, may require multiple sessions to achieve the best results. This can increase the overall cost of treatment. For example, a single microneedling session may not be enough to significantly reduce the appearance of large pores, meaning you may need to budget for several appointments. On the other hand, at-home products like retinoids may be effective with continued use but without the need for multiple visits to a professional.
Skin Type and Pore Severity
Your skin type and the severity of your pore concerns will also influence the treatment plan. Individuals with more extensive pore issues or those with oily or acne-prone skin may benefit from more intensive treatments like laser resurfacing or deep chemical peels. These treatments, while effective, can be pricier due to the advanced techniques and equipment involved. If you have milder concerns, less invasive treatments or topical products may be sufficient, providing a more budget-friendly option.
Long-Term Maintenance
While some treatments provide lasting results, others may require periodic touch-ups to maintain their effectiveness. For example, laser treatments and microneedling may require maintenance sessions every few months to keep pores minimized and skin looking smooth. When planning your treatment budget, it’s essential to consider not just the initial cost but also the potential for ongoing treatments to maintain results.
Location and Practitioner Expertise
The location of the treatment and the expertise of the practitioner can also impact the cost. Clinics in larger cities or upscale areas tend to charge higher rates for procedures, while smaller or more accessible locations may offer more affordable options. Additionally, practitioners with specialized expertise or advanced certifications may charge more for their services, but they may also provide higher-quality results.
Tips for Managing the Cost of Large Pores Treatments
Managing the cost of large pores treatments involves more than just selecting the right treatment option—it also requires strategic planning to maximize the effectiveness of your investment. Here are a few tips to help you manage your treatment budget while still achieving the desired results.
Combine Professional Treatments with At-Home Care
One way to manage costs is by combining professional treatments with at-home care. For example, you can undergo a series of chemical peels or microneedling sessions to kickstart your treatment, then maintain your results with affordable at-home products like exfoliating cleansers and pore-minimizing serums. This hybrid approach allows you to enjoy the benefits of professional treatments while still incorporating budget-friendly solutions into your skincare routine.
Look for Package Deals
Many clinics offer package deals for multiple sessions of a particular treatment, which can often save you money in the long run. Instead of paying for individual sessions, you may find that purchasing a package for several treatments comes with a discount. Be sure to inquire about any package deals or seasonal promotions to get the best value for your money.
